Fine motor skills are crucial for children aged 4-9, particularly in relation to the letter "M." These skills involve the small muscles in their hands and fingers, which are essential for tasks such as writing, cutting, and buttoning clothes. Learning to write the letter "M" not only enhances letter recognition but also promotes hand-eye coordination and dexterity.
For parents and teachers, fostering fine motor skills lays the foundation for academic success and everyday functionality. Mastering the formation of "M" requires children to use controlled movements, strengthening their grip and improving precision. This skill translates to other writing tasks as they progress in school, affecting their overall literacy and communication abilities.
Moreover, activities that focus on the letter "M," such as arts and crafts, playdough activities, and tracing, provide an engaging way for children to practice. Integrating these activities into daily routines can make learning both effective and enjoyable.
